    If you really want to know for sure what temp each open at, I would suggest putting both in a pan of water with a meat / candy thermometer, slowly raise the heat to observe when & at what temp each one opens. Frank beat me to it, but I put them both in at the same time. Bonzi Lon

  15. [quote=EverRude;360561 So all in all I'm happy. BTW 3 screw carbs suck. There's a boss on side of carb body that prevents the float bowl lid from coming off and being installed with the float attached. WTH is with that? The 4 screws have no such boss and the float lids lift straight up without a need to remove floats first. Was it only on the rear carb? I had the same problem, could not get that lid off no mater which way I tried. Solved that problem by sawing off the offending ear. It appears the redesign for the 3 screw included using the same casting for both front & rear carbs, as this boss is on the other side for the choke bracket attachment.   18. Bonzi Lon posted a post in a topic in Interior
    The plastic panels in my 73 looked just like yours, until I sprayed them with SEM Vinyl Dye '15103 Super White', they turned out great. Covers well, very tough. The staining on the tunnel is from the interaction of the glue and the fake jute / fake horse hair insulation under the vinyl. It may get destroyed when you take the vinyl off. The vinyl on mine was not as bad and cleaned up fairly well, but does not match the plastic. In time the rest of the interior will get SEM'd. (Still up in the air: white seats? or black seats?) The least expensive route to go, or think about. Use your black buckets and SEM the plastic & vinyl on the white parts, may not need to do the headliner. The blue plastic strip could be done in the exterior color. Just a thought. Bonzi Lon
